Mexico’s National Dance Company is one of the most important and long-standing companies of Mexico, It was created as an Institution that seeks to merge Classical, Neoclassical and Contemporary Dance. From its dounfing, the Natioanl Dance Company has been directed by prestigious international figures. For the last 50 years, the National Dance Company has educated dancers with a solid academic training.
